VS  Besiktas CT vs. Galatasaray CC Turin will be turned into a Turkish battleground for the ULEB Cup Final Eight quarterfinal showdown between Besiktas Cola Turka and Galatasaray Cafe Crown. Both clubs are not just Turkish League foes, but they are Istanbul city rivals as well. The two teams have also met twice domestically this season with the visiting side victorious both times. Galatasaray won the first match-up 75-80 in late November as Charles Gaines had 14 points to lead six Galatasaray scorers in double figures.
The two teams battled again on March 7 at Galatasaray's home and Besiktas clubbed the hosts 66-83. Shumpert's 20 points led a balanced effort as Besiktas shot 63%, while holding Galatasaray to 35% shooting, including just 7 of 29 (24%) from long range. Both teams feature well-balanced squads, who were among the better rebounding teams this season and also committed few turnovers. Besiktas's frontcourt of Kaya Peker, Sandro Nicevic and Predrag Drobnjak is big in size and experience, which makes the absence of injured Galatasaray center Huseyon Besok especially meaningful. Athletic forwards Owens and Gaines will look to Fatih Solak and Cemal Nalga to help out in the paint. Besiktas guard Christian Dalmau, who missed his team's last Turkish League contest, is expected to play as usual, joining Apodaca, Shumpert and Sinan Guler in a lethal shooting backcourt, which will match up with Brown, Hite and Cuneyt Erden. Galatasaray's experienced small forwards Cenk Akyol and Britton Johnsen could prove to be x-factors with their contributions, whether it be scoring, on the glass or on defense against Shumpert. This game has all the makings of a classic ULEB Cup encounter that will be remembered for a long time and could come down to which team's shooter of choice is hottest in the closing minutes.
